4.9 Verifying and Reading Keycards
4.9.1 Verifying a Guest Keycard
Purpose: If a Guest level keycard is not functioning properly, it
can be verified using the “Read/Verify” function. The
guest’s room number encoded on the keycard must
be known for this function, unless the FDU is
configured to not require it (see Section 3.6 part 14 –
Guest Keycard Read Back Enable without Room for
details).
Minimum authorization level: Front Desk Authorization
